Additional information

The Church of All Saints at Jordanville, New York — home to Holy Trinity Monastery, the largest Russian Orthodox monastery in North America — became a point of cultural survival for the post-revolutionary Russian diaspora. Founded by émigré monks in the 1930s, the monastery preserved liturgical traditions and printed religious texts that were suppressed inside the Soviet Union for decades.

Cook Islands became a prolific issuer of themed silver rounds in the 2000s, producing dozens of religious architecture pieces under KM numbers that run well into the thousands. Collector demand rather than domestic circulation drove the series entirely.
